Hi Ingo,
I don't doubt that this is the case for everyone.
The problem is that because the segment identifier is a per-atom
property, it is not easy for coot to know what the segment identifier
for the new atoms should be. It could guess of course, but I'm not sure
that that would be a whole lot better than the current situation.
